French adaptation of the novel. :smack:

2004: Les Revenants (movie) - English title: They Came Back
2012: Les Revenants (TV series, based on/rebooted version of the above) English title: The Returned
2013: The Returned (book by Jason Mott, which is supposedly not at all connected to the above, honest)
2014: Resurrection (TV series) based on Jason Mott novel
